Virginia Commonwealth State Agency-Northrop Grumman Critical System Outage The commonwealth of Virginia experienced an information technology storage area network outage on August 25th 2010. This affected several agencies and caused 13% of the file servers to fail. The failure mainly impacted the Department of Motor Vehicles and Department of taxation. Relational Systems Relational systems are the relationships formed between workmates in an organization when they coordinate their tasks, goals, and missions. Moreover, they pertain to the human system, as they are composed of individuals moving towards or away from one other. In fact, they tend to form patterns while interacting or drifting from each other (Kahn, Barton, & Fellows, 2013). Systems theory is a relatively new concept developed in the 20th century. Originally meant to apply understanding to physical systems today it is now being used to understand biological and social systems (Minuchin, 1985). Adopted by social workers in the 1970’s the system perspective remains influential and in particular when dealing with families. Family systems theory is broken into 3 domains.
